400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el中向左查找要什么函数

作者:路由通
|
283人看过
发布时间:2026-01-29 16:36:44
标签:
在数据处理中,反向查找是常见需求。本文将深入解析在表格软件中实现向左查找的核心函数——查找与引用(VLOOKUP)的逆向应用、索引(INDEX)与匹配(MATCH)组合,以及查询(XLOOKUP)新函数的强大功能。文章通过详尽的原理解析、多场景对比和实用案例,系统指导您掌握从右向左精准定位数据的全套方法,提升数据匹配效率。
excel中向左查找要什么函数

       在日常办公与数据分析中,我们常常遇到这样的场景:目标数据位于查找值的左侧,而常规的纵向查找函数默认只能向右返回结果。面对这种“向左查找”的需求,许多使用者会感到束手无策,甚至采用复杂且容易出错的辅助列方法。实际上,掌握正确的函数组合与思路,向左查找可以变得轻松而高效。本文将为您系统性地剖析实现向左查找的多种函数方案,从经典组合到新式函数,从原理到实战,助您彻底攻克这一数据操作难点。

       理解查找方向:为何常规方法失效

       在深入探讨具体函数之前,我们首先要理解查找方向的本质。大多数用户最先接触的查找函数是查找与引用(VLOOKUP)。这个函数的设计逻辑是,在一个指定的表格区域中,先在第一列(最左列)搜索某个值,找到后,再向右移动指定的列数,返回该单元格的值。其参数结构决定了它“只能向右看”的特性。因此,当您需要返回的值位于查找列的左边时,查找与引用(VLOOKUP)便直接宣告无效。这种设计源于数据表格通常将唯一标识(如工号、产品编号)放在最左侧的惯例。然而,现实中的数据源千变万化,常常并非理想结构,这就催生了对逆向查找技术的迫切需求。

       经典之王:索引(INDEX)与匹配(MATCH)组合

       这是解决向左查找问题最经典、最灵活且兼容性最强的方案。它并非一个单独的函数,而是由两个函数默契配合而成的“黄金搭档”。索引(INDEX)函数的作用是,给定一个区域和行号、列号,返回该交叉点单元格的值。匹配(MATCH)函数的作用是,在单行或单列中搜索指定值,并返回其相对位置。

       组合使用的公式基本结构为:=索引(返回结果所在的整个区域, 匹配(查找值, 查找值所在的单列区域, 0), 列号)。这里的精髓在于“分离”。查找与引用(VLOOKUP)将查找列和返回列捆绑在同一个区域,而索引(INDEX)与匹配(MATCH)组合则将它们解放开来。您可以独立指定查找值所在的列(可以是目标左侧的任何列),再独立指定要返回的值所在的列(可以是查找列左侧或右侧的任何列),匹配(MATCH)函数负责找到正确的行,索引(INDEX)函数则根据这个行号和您指定的列号去抓取数据。如此一来,查找方向便不再受限制。

       实战解析索引(INDEX)与匹配(MATCH)

       假设有一个员工信息表,A列是部门,B列是员工姓名,C列是员工工号。现在我们需要根据B列的“员工姓名”,去查找其左侧A列的“部门”。使用组合公式为:=索引($A$2:$A$100, 匹配(“张三”, $B$2:$B$100, 0))。公式解读:匹配(MATCH)函数在$B$2:$B$100区域中精确查找“张三”,并返回其在该区域中的行号(例如第5行)。索引(INDEX)函数则在$A$2:$A$100区域中,返回第5行的值,即该员工所在的部门。整个过程清晰地将查找列(B列)和返回列(A列)分离,完美实现向左查找。

       新锐利器:查询(XLOOKUP)函数的降维打击

       如果您使用的是微软Office 365或较新版本的表格软件,那么查询(XLOOKUP)函数将是您解决查找问题(包括向左查找)的终极武器。它被设计用来替代查找与引用(VLOOKUP)和横向查找(HLOOKUP),其语法更加简洁直观,功能更加强大。查询(XLOOKUP)函数的基本语法是:=查询(查找值, 查找数组, 返回数组, [未找到值], [匹配模式], [搜索模式])。

       其实现向左查找的奥秘在于参数设计的独立性。您只需在“查找数组”参数中指定查找值所在的列(范围),在“返回数组”参数中指定要返回的值所在的列(范围)。这两个数组区域是独立的,没有左右位置的束缚。因此,无论“返回数组”位于“查找数组”的左边还是右边,查询(XLOOKUP)都能轻松应对。继续以上述员工表为例,公式可写为:=查询(“张三”, $B$2:$B$100, $A$2:$A$100)。此公式一目了然,可读性极强,直接表达了“在B列找张三,找到后返回对应A列的值”的逻辑。

       查询(XLOOKUP)的进阶优势

       除了方向自由,查询(XLOOKUP)还内置了许多实用特性。它默认执行精确匹配,无需像查找与引用(VLOOKUP)那样额外设置“0”或“假(FALSE)”。它允许您自定义查找不到内容时的返回结果(如显示“未找到”),避免了复杂的错误处理嵌套。它支持从下至上的反向搜索,这在某些场景下非常有用。可以说,查询(XLOOKUP)以一己之力简化了几乎所有查找场景的公式编写。

       查找与引用(VLOOKUP)的“曲线救国”术

       在不支持查询(XLOOKUP)的旧版软件环境中,如果坚持使用查找与引用(VLOOKUP),是否就无路可走了呢?并非如此,有一种经典的“辅助列”思路。其核心思想是,通过函数构造一个新的数据区域,将原本在左侧的返回列,“搬运”到查找列的右侧,从而让查找与引用(VLOOKUP)能够工作。最常用的方法是使用连接符“&”或者选择(CHOOSE)函数。

       例如,仍要根-据姓名找部门。可以在原表格旁插入一列,使用公式将部门和姓名合并成一个新的唯一键,如=D2=A2&B2。然后,使用查找与引用(VLOOKUP)在这个新构造的区域进行查找:=查找与引用(“销售部张三”, $D$2:$E$100, 2, 假(FALSE)),其中返回列是姓名。这种方法虽然能达成目的,但需要改动原数据表结构,增加了维护成本,且公式不够直观,容易出错,一般作为备选方案。

       横向查找(HLOOKUP)的横向世界

       虽然本文聚焦于纵向数据的向左查找,但原理同样适用于横向排列的数据。横向查找(HLOOKUP)是查找与引用(VLOOKUP)的横向版本,它在首行查找值,并向下返回指定行的值。当需要向左查找时,它面临与查找与引用(VLOOKUP)相同的困境。解决方案同样是使用索引(INDEX)与匹配(MATCH)组合,或者查询(XLOOKUP)。只需将索引(INDEX)的行列参数逻辑进行对调,或为查询(XLOOKUP)正确指定横向的查找数组和返回数组即可。

       匹配(MATCH)函数的精确与模糊

       在索引(INDEX)与匹配(MATCH)组合中,匹配(MATCH)函数的匹配类型参数至关重要。参数“0”代表精确匹配,这是向左查找最常用的模式。参数“1”代表小于等于查找值的最大值的匹配,要求查找区域必须升序排列。参数“-1”代表大于等于查找值的最小值的匹配,要求查找区域降序排列。在向左查找中,除非进行特殊的区间查找,否则务必使用精确匹配(0),以确保结果的准确性。

       动态区域与绝对引用

       无论使用哪种方案,公式中区域的引用方式都直接影响其稳定性和可复制性。强烈建议对查找区域和返回区域使用绝对引用(如$A$2:$A$100),或将其定义为表格名称。这样可以防止在复制公式时,引用区域发生意外的偏移,导致计算错误。特别是在使用索引(INDEX)与匹配(MATCH)组合时,确保两个函数所引用的区域在行数上保持一致,是正确计算的基础。

       处理查找不到的错误

       在实际应用中,查找值可能不存在。查找与引用(VLOOKUP)和索引(INDEX)与匹配(MATCH)组合在查找失败时会返回错误值“N/A”。为了使表格更美观和专业,可以使用容错函数将其包裹。例如:=如果错误(索引(匹配(…组合公式), “”)。这样,当查找不到时,单元格会显示为空或其他您指定的提示文本。查询(XLOOKUP)则直接在第四个参数中内置了这一功能,更加便捷。

       多条件向左查找的进阶应用

       现实情况往往更复杂,可能需要根据两个或以上的条件向左查找数据。例如,根据“部门”和“姓名”两个条件,查找其左侧的“项目编号”。此时,索引(INDEX)与匹配(MATCH)组合依然能胜任,但匹配(MATCH)部分需要使用数组公式或新版动态数组函数。一种通用方法是使用连接符构建复合查找值:=索引(返回列, 匹配(条件1&条件2, 查找列1&查找列2, 0)),输入时需按特定组合键确认。而查询(XLOOKUP)则可以更优雅地实现多条件查找,其查找数组和查找值均支持使用数组运算,公式更为简洁。

       性能考量与大数据集

       当处理数万行乃至更多数据时,函数的计算效率变得重要。索引(INDEX)与匹配(MATCH)组合通常被认为比在大型区域中使用查找与引用(VLOOKUP)效率更高,因为匹配(MATCH)只搜索一列,索引(INDEX)直接定位。查询(XLOOKUP)作为现代函数,其引擎也进行了优化。对于超大数据集,应尽量避免使用涉及整列引用(如A:A)的公式,而是精确限定数据范围,以减少计算量。

       场景选择与决策指南

       面对向左查找的需求,您该如何选择?我们给出清晰的决策路径:首先,确认您的软件版本。如果支持查询(XLOOKUP),请毫不犹豫地选择它,这是最简洁、最强大的方案。其次,如果版本较旧,索引(INDEX)与匹配(MATCH)组合是首选,它灵活、兼容性好,是专业人士的标配。最后,查找与引用(VLOOKUP)配合辅助列的方法,仅在不便修改公式逻辑且对表格结构有完全控制权的特殊情况下考虑。

       融会贯通:构建查找模板

       为了提升日常工作效率,建议您创建属于自己的数据查找模板。在一个空白工作表中,分别使用索引(INDEX)与匹配(MATCH)组合和查询(XLOOKUP)函数,搭建好向左、向右、多条件查找的公式框架,并做好清晰的注释。当下次遇到类似需求时,只需将模板中的区域引用替换为实际数据区域,即可快速得到结果。这不仅能节省时间,更能保证公式的准确性。

       常见误区与排错检查

       在实践向左查找时,有几个常见错误点需要警惕:一是匹配(MATCH)函数的查找区域与索引(INDEX)的返回区域行数不一致;二是查找值中存在不可见的空格或字符,导致匹配失败,可使用修剪(TRIM)或清除(CLEAN)函数预处理;三是数字格式与文本格式混淆,看似相同的数字,可能一个是数值型,一个是文本型,导致无法匹配;四是忘记输入匹配类型参数,或错误地使用了模糊匹配。

       从函数思维到数据建模思维

       掌握向左查找的技术,不仅仅是学会几个函数。它背后体现的是一种数据建模的思维:将数据的“查找键”与“返回值”分离,通过函数建立它们之间的动态链接。这种思维有助于您设计更合理、更灵活的数据表格结构,即使原始数据源排列不佳,也能通过函数模型高效、准确地获取所需信息。当您能熟练运用索引(INDEX)、匹配(MATCH)、查询(XLOOKUP)这些工具时,您处理数据的视角和能力都将提升到一个新的层次。

       综上所述,在表格软件中实现向左查找,已不再是难题。从经典的索引(INDEX)与匹配(MATCH)黄金组合,到革命性的查询(XLOOKUP)函数,您拥有了多种可靠的解决方案。关键在于理解其分离查找列与返回列的核心原理,并根据实际环境和需求选择最合适的工具。希望这篇详尽的指南能成为您手边的得力参考,助您在数据的世界里游刃有余。

相关文章
稀土永磁什么用
稀土永磁材料,作为现代工业与尖端科技的“维生素”,其应用已渗透至国民经济与国防安全的众多核心领域。本文将从材料特性出发,系统阐述其在节能电机、风力发电、新能源汽车、消费电子、工业自动化、医疗设备、航空航天及国防军事等十二个关键领域的核心作用与原理,揭示这种战略性材料如何驱动技术创新与产业升级,塑造我们的现代生活。
2026-01-29 16:36:29
169人看过
什么树莓好
树莓品种繁多,选择“好”的树莓需综合考虑品种特性、栽培目的与地域适应性。本文将系统解析鲜食、加工等不同用途下的优选品种,从果实风味、产量、抗病性及气候匹配度等核心维度,提供一份覆盖主流与特色品种的详尽选购与种植指南,助您找到最适合的那一颗“红宝石”。
2026-01-29 16:35:46
34人看过
word贴note是什么意思
“Word贴Note”这一表述,并非软件内置的官方功能术语,而是一种生动形象的用户行为概括。它通常指将微软的Word文档内容,通过复制、嵌入、引用或链接等方式,“贴”入微软的OneNote笔记中,实现两类文档的优势互补与信息整合。这一操作背后,涉及文档编辑与知识管理思维的融合,是提升个人或团队工作效率与信息组织能力的重要实践。
2026-01-29 16:34:55
141人看过
excel日期为什么会变格式
在日常使用电子表格软件处理日期数据时,许多人都会遇到一个令人困惑的现象:明明输入了特定格式的日期,它却自动变成了另一副模样。这种日期格式的“自动变身”并非软件故障,其背后涉及软件底层的数据处理逻辑、区域设置、单元格格式以及数据类型识别等多个核心机制。理解这些原因,能帮助我们更精准地掌控数据,避免在数据分析、报表制作中因格式错乱而产生错误。
2026-01-29 16:34:29
78人看过
流量看视频一小时多少
观看视频一小时消耗的流量,并非固定数值,它如同一个光谱,从几十兆到数吉字节不等,具体取决于视频清晰度、平台编码技术、是否开启弹幕等互动功能,以及网络环境波动。理解这些变量并掌握流量估算方法,是避免套餐超额、优化观看体验的关键。本文将深入剖析各主流清晰度的流量消耗,并提供实用的计算与节省指南。
2026-01-29 16:34:23
398人看过
htcone多少钱
如果您正在询问“HTC One多少钱”,那么您指的很可能是一个跨越数年的经典产品系列,而非单一型号。从2013年震撼业界的全金属机身先驱HTC One(M7),到后续的M8、M9等迭代机型,其价格因型号、发布时间、配置和市场状况差异巨大。本文将为您深度梳理HTC One系列主要型号的历史发售价、不同渠道的当前行情以及影响其价格的诸多核心因素,助您清晰把握这款昔日安卓旗舰的“价值变迁史”。
2026-01-29 16:34:21
39人看过